1.购买烧录器pwlink2.下载Power Writer烧录软件。3.在keil5里面设置,如下: 注:此步骤前需要先将烧录器和stm32f103c8t6开发板连好,接到电脑上,之后才能在1处看到设备。 下面这个烧录步骤可能会报错,如果报错往下看。 可能会报错,如下: 这就是个巨坑的问题,原因时购买的芯片不是正版,是国内的,坑的一批。处理方法如下:参考:https://blog.csdn.net/chunquqiulailll/article/details/113257923一句话概括就是正版是STM32F1系列的IDCODE为0x1B10477,国产山寨我所购买的STM32C8T6核
一、SG90舵机介绍SG90是一种微型舵机,也被称为伺服电机。它是一种小型、低成本的直流电机,通常用于模型和机器人控制等应用中。SG90舵机可以通过电子信号来控制其精确的位置和速度。它具有体积小、重量轻、响应快等特点,因此在各种小型机械设备上得到了广泛应用。SG90舵机通常用于各种小型机械设备中,例如:模型控制:SG90舵机可以用于遥控汽车、飞机、船只和其他模型的转向、加速和刹车等控制。机器人控制:SG90舵机也广泛应用于机器人领域,例如可以控制机器人的头部旋转、臂部移动等。相机云台:SG90舵机可以用于控制相机的运动,例如实现云台的左右旋转和上下移动。自动化系统:在一些自动化系统中,SG90
前言 最近在学习用stm32制作,于是乎在某宝上面买了一个最小系统。我身边因为没有STLink、JLink等烧录器。无法烧录,痛苦面具的我差点就要去买一个烧录器,好在突然想起我之前搞蓝牙调试的时候有一块USBtoTTL模块,我可以用它来烧录程序,做一下笔记备忘。stm32f103c8t6最小系统开发板USBtoTTL模块使用USBtoTLL模块烧录程序的全过程 1、USBtoTTL模块的GND 连接 开发板的GND 2、USBtoTTL模块的3.3V 连接 开发板的3.3V 3、USBtoTTL模块的TXD 连接 开发板的PA10
记录项目的详细制作过程,所以笔记很长,图很多、很多图不好CSDN搬运,我把笔记放网盘或者自己根据资料下载笔记网盘下载:链接:https://pan.baidu.com/s/1Mk2EVIha7Fpj4Xductg3Uw?pwd=VCC1提取码:VCC1笔记CSDN下载:第一章-硬件1.1-元件选型[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-R0hM1EjE-1675083353042)(https://hjhvcc.oss-cn-nanjing.aliyuncs.com/img/20230130191750.png)]1.2-原理图与PCB底板原理图各个模块的
STM32F103-SIM900A发短信+串口打印基本介绍一:单独测试1.准备工作2.接线3.指令操作4.测试结果二:关于Unicode编码Unicode基本介绍三:代码编写sim900a.csim900a.hmain.c项目演示总结最近用STM32F103做一个智能门锁小玩意,密码输入错误次数多进行验证码解锁,这里我采用SIM900A来通过发送短信输入验证码进行解锁。就是简单的了解了一下在这里也单独的写写这个SIM900A的一写笔记。基本介绍。。。。。。还是直接进入主题吧一:单独测试SIM900A是可以AT指令操作的,所以一般我拿到这种模块就是先单独的测试一下这个模块是否正常。通过一个USB
文章目录一、电路总览二、单片机部分三、电源和通信部分附录:PCB提要学点啥系列之——STM32F103ZET6核心板制作指引原创资料,转载请联系作者的话:会画stm32F103ZET6的话,rct6啥的简直不要太简单一、电路总览图1:电路整体二、单片机部分要做一块核心板,首先要搞清楚自己想在这块板子上加啥东西。依照思路,一块单片机最小系统,应该要有电源(三处讲)、单片机本身、复位电路以及时钟电路。我们先从单片机本身入手,如图2所示,是本次的主角,STM32F103ZET6图2:STM32F103ZET6翻开数据手册,查一下,如图3:图3:数据手册的zet6从数据手册中我们可以获知这LQFP封装
目录一、前言二、固件库三、寄存器四、用固件库控制LED——亮灭灯五、用寄存器控制LED——亮灭灯六、总结一、前言(如果不想了解怎么找到野火的官方文件的或已经知道怎么找的,可以跳过前言这一部分) 要想学会一款单片机,先要学会看懂单片机的硬件部分。图1.1是野火指南者的硬件部分介绍图1.1 当然了,除了硬看硬件也可以看野火给出的资料。首先,百度找到野火电子论坛图1.2图1.3找到在上方菜单中的下载中心,找到资料中心图1.4 点击进去就可以看到图1.5的内容,点击那个指南者STM32F103开发板就可以找到官方的资料了。图1.5图1.6 官方不仅免费提供我们指南者的资还提供标准库和HAL库开
: 本教程基于up主江科大自化协——“STM32入门教程”记录的个人学习笔记跳转链接:STM32入门教程-2022持续更新中_哔哩哔哩_bilibili1.简介•TIM(Timer)定时器•定时器可以对输入的时钟进行计数,并在计数值达到设定值时触发中断•16位计数器、预分频器、自动重装寄存器的时基单元,在72MHz计数时钟下可以实现最大59.65s(1/72/65536/65536)的定时•不仅具备基本的定时中断功能,而且还包含内外时钟源选择、输入捕获、输出比较、编码器接口、主从触发模式等多种功能•根据复杂度和应用场景分为了高级定时器、通用定时器、基本定时器三种类型 (注:高级定时器中,重复计
: 本教程基于up主江科大自化协——“STM32入门教程”记录的个人学习笔记跳转链接:STM32入门教程-2022持续更新中_哔哩哔哩_bilibili1.简介•TIM(Timer)定时器•定时器可以对输入的时钟进行计数,并在计数值达到设定值时触发中断•16位计数器、预分频器、自动重装寄存器的时基单元,在72MHz计数时钟下可以实现最大59.65s(1/72/65536/65536)的定时•不仅具备基本的定时中断功能,而且还包含内外时钟源选择、输入捕获、输出比较、编码器接口、主从触发模式等多种功能•根据复杂度和应用场景分为了高级定时器、通用定时器、基本定时器三种类型 (注:高级定时器中,重复计
目录前言功能介绍:工程下载:效果图STA模式TCP服务器控制LED1的亮灭AP模式TCP客户端控制蜂鸣器的开关、步进电机正反转AP模式TCP服务器读取温湿度STA模式TCP客户端连接手机热点与云服务器建立通信实现云端控制1、云服务器的测试环境搭建配置2、源程序修改烧写3、STM32相关功能配置和测试核心代码前言前期准备可以参考我的这篇文章STM32F103+ESP8266(WiFi)模块实现AP模式下的TCPC/S和UDPClient,重复部分不再赘述。功能介绍:APSTASTA+AP模式下,建立tcp/udp连接后,发送指定命令,控制LED1和蜂鸣器的开关,读取DHT11模块温湿度数据,控制